Preparation
Preparation Instructions
1. Mix the Ouzo
In a glass, pour 1 cup of ouzo.
2. Add Water
Slowly add 1 cup of chilled water to the glass. This will create a milky appearance due to the anise oils.
3. Add Ice
Add ice cubes to taste. This keeps the drink cool and refreshing.
4. Garnish
Garnish with lemon slices for added flavor and presentation.
5. Serve
Serve immediately and enjoy your traditional Greek ouzo!
